Business Casual Maxi Dresses

  1. Wear a normal bra, and keep it covered.
  2. Keep your shoes professional.
  3. Cover your arms and shoulders with a fitted shape.
  4. Dress it up with accessories.
  5. Keep your hair neat and tidy, such as in an office updo.

Can you wear dresses for business casual?

So, are dresses business casual? Dresses are considered business casual when they are styled appropriately for an office environment, e.g. of a simple colour or pattern, knee length and of a conservative fit. Avoid short or revealing dresses, dresses intended for evening wear or dresses of a t-shirt material.

Can you wear a blazer with a maxi dress?

Blazer: Transition your maxi dress from beach to boardroom by pairing it with a blazer. This structured shape creates a streamlined look and paired with heels keeps the rest of your look professional.
